Early rupture of the amniotic is one of the causes of asphyxia because the rupture of the oligohydramnios membrane that presses on the umbilical cord so that it experiences asphyxia so that gestational age is related to asphyxia because the aging process causes the placenta to function less optimally so that it can cause asphyxia. This purpose is to determine the relationship between early rupture of amniotics and maternal gestational age with the incidence of neonatoral asphyxia at the RSUD Kabupaten Indramayu in 2022. This studied used a cross-sectional design analytical descriptive method using a Retrospective approach, the population in my studied was all babies who experienced asphyxia with a total sample of 80 respondents using simple random sampling while the research instrument used a checklist sheet of research data using secondary data from medical records, and data analysis techniques using the Chi Square test by reading using pearson chi square. The results of this studied showed no relationship between the amniotic rupture early and the incidence of neonatoral asphyxia (p-value 0.408), and there was no relationship between the gestational age of the mother and the incidence of neonatoral asphyxia (p-value 0.424), because the results of this studied did not have a relationship, it was believed that there were other factors that influenced the incidence of neonatoral asphyxia, namely factors of maternal state, preeclampsia, bleeding, and old or stalled partus. The advice in this studied is that it is hoped that future studies will examine samples of babies who have asphyxia and do not experience asphyxia because it is to be a comparison and further analysis is carried out to make it more valid.

The SmartCampus application is still built with a monolithic architecture, where all components are tightly integrated into one unit. The increasing complexity of user scalability and service demands within the information system with a monolithic architecture is evident in the application's declining performance. In this research, a performance analysis is conducted by implementing refactoring from a monolithic architecture to microservices using the decomposition and strangler patterns. The Decomposition pattern divides the monolithic application into several business domains based on their main service categories, while the strangler pattern breaks down the business domains into microservices by replacing specific functions with new services through the stages of transform, co-exist, and eliminate. Once the new functionalities are ready, the old components are deactivated, and the new services are put into operation. The application's feasibility and quality considerations are assessed using the ISO/IEC 25010 model, which comprises eight characteristics: functionality suitability, performance efficiency, compatibility, usability, reliability, security, maintainability, and portability. The performance of the resulting microservices application is tested using different performance testing types, such as load testing, spike testing, stress testing, and soak testing. Microservices showing satisfactory performance improvements will be isolated using container technology to optimize application resource efficiency and anticipate long-term needs

The development of tourist destinations in Indonesia can encourage an increase in tourist visits and the length of stay of tourists while in tourist destinations. Tourism destination development needs to be in line with the characteristics of the tourism destinations they have. This study conducted a cluster analysis to map 34 provinces in Indonesia based on 13 aspects of tourism characteristics and carrying capacity. Mapping results formed four groups of tourist destinations with similar characteristics. Cluster-1 has the best average tourist carrying capacity, so it is classified as an advanced destination group consisting of West Java, Central Java, DI Yogyakarta, East Java, and Bali. Cluster-2 consists of DKI Jakarta and Riau Island, with two bad aspects, so they are classified as the revitalization of tourist destinations. Cluster-3 consists of North Sumatra, West Sumatra, Banten, West Nusa Tenggara, East Nusa Tenggara, West Kalimantan, East Kalimantan, South Kalimantan, South Sulawesi, North Sulawesi, and West Papua, which have poor performance in 6 aspects so that it is categorized as a developing tourism destination. Cluster-4 comprises 16 other provinces with poor performance in 9 elements, so it is classified as a pioneering tourist destination. Mapping results are compared with the policies of 10 priority tourism destinations (DPP) in Indonesia, and it is found that 3 DPPs (Bangka Belitung, Morotai-North Maluku, and Wakatobi-Southeast Sulawesi) are included in cluster-4 with the category of pioneer tourist destinations. Development of these 3 DPPs requires increased funding.

Utilizing carbon materials derived from natural biomass holds significant promise for battery applications, owing to their low cost, abundant availability, and environmentally sustainable characteristics. However, graphite anode materials do not meet the demands of efficient batteries. Coconut shell waste has the potential to be used as activated carbon in energy storage anodes. By adding silicon dioxide (SiO2) to maintain structural stability and electrochemical reaction kinetics, the advantages of CCS can be maximized. Polyacrylonitrile/polyvinylidene fluoride (PAN/PVDF) composite polymer was used as a matrix to embed CCS/SiO2 and synthesize nanofibers via electrospinning. The resulting nanofibers had diameters ranging from to 575–707 nm, with cross-linked, porous, and beadless characteristics. Mechanical properties were measured by single-fiber micro tensile tests. The young modulus, tensile strength, and toughness of each nanofiber were successfully maintained at 13.7 ± 0.4 MPa, 34.4 ± 0.1 MPa, and 982 ± 10 kJ/m3, respectively, because of the presence of a β-crystal growth layer that facilitated efficient stress transmission. The reduction-oxidation process response had a potential difference of less than 1.286 V in the first cycle, whereas for the third and fifth cycles, it was maintained below 3.416 V. The lithium-ion diffusion coefficient was below 4.73×1013 cm2/s. Using the anode directly, as in lithium-ion batteries, provided a high capacity of 382 mAh/g after 200 cycles. Good cycle stability, with over 98% retention of the initial capacitance after 200 charge/discharge cycles, underscores its potential for application in lithium-ion batteries.

This study explores the relationship between sustainable IT capabilities and ISM Assimilation in organizations. By focusing on three key Sustainable IT Capabilities, namely IT Infrastructure, IT Business Spanning Capability, and IT Proactive Stance, this study investigates how these three capabilities influence the integration of ISM practices in an organizational context. Data collected from 157 upper management level employees at several companies in Indonesia that implemented ISM were analyzed using structural equation modeling. The data were analyzed with SEM PLS and SmartPLS 4.0 software. The results showed a positive influence of sustainable IT capabilities on ISM Assimilation. So the three factors of sustainable IT capabilities, namely: IT Infrastructure, I T Business Spanning Capability, and IT Proactive Stance have a positive effect on ISM Assimilation. These findings provide valuable insights for organizational leaders and business owners to develop sustainable IT strategies that enhance information security and promote the assimilation of ISM practices for sustainable asset management.

Hydroquinone is a hazardous and toxic chemical often added to cosmetics due to bleaching properties. It is commonly analyzed in cosmetics using expensive and time-consuming instruments, showing the need for a cheap, fast, and sensitive hydroquinone electrochemical sensor. The performance of electrochemical sensor to detect hydroquinone is determined by the working electrode. Therefore, this study aimed to explore the synthesis of Au-Pd-NPs working electrode and application as electrochemical sensor of hydroquinone in cosmetics. Synthesis process was carried out by preparing Au-NPs using banana peel extract (Musa acuminata Colla) as a bioreductor, followed by adding H2PdCl4 solution. Au-NPs nanoparticle was confirmed using Ultraviolet-Visible spectrophotometer, which showed maximum wavelength of 550 nm. The indication of Au-Pd-NPs was shown by the peak at the same wavelength. The FTIR spectrum showed pectin which acted as a bioreductant agent in synthesis of nanoparticles. The results of the TEM image showed that Au-NPs had a spherical shape in the dark field with a diameter of 38.5 ± 3.3 nm and a Pd shell layer around the Au core in the bright field with a diameter of 12.4 ± 2.6 nm. The solid Au-Pd-NPs materials were made into a composite electrode by adding PVC and tetrahydrofuran as solvents. Electrochemical response of Au-Pd-NPs electrode was tested by cyclic voltammetry in ferricyanide and PBS solutions at pH 7.0. Based on CV in the ferricyanide system, it shows that Au-Pd-NPs electrode produces peak oxidation and reduction currents ten times higher than Au-NPs. These data indicate that Au-Pd-NPs are more reactive and sensitive than Au-NPs electrodes. The Au-Pd-NPs electrode was used to analysis the concentration of hydroquinone in cosmetics samples. Electrochemical response showed a linearity (R2) of 0.9935 in concentration range of 0-60 mM, containing 1.12% hydroquinone.
